The 2015 Bronx LGBTQ Pride Awards Dinner was held at Eastwood Manor on Tuesday, July 14. Honorees were James Palacio, also known as Empress Fiona St. James, receiving the Rev. Magora E. Kennedy Stonewall Courage Award; Tyra Ross, Brenda Howard Community Spirit of Pride Award; Bronx Council on the Arts’ Longwood Art Gallery, the DJ Frankie Knuckles Pride in the Arts Award; Sean Coleman, the Christine Jorgensen Trailblazer Award; Lewis Goldstein, the Stormé DeLarverie Memorial Award; and Lissette Marrero, the Luis Freddy Molano-Polanco Advocacy in Health Award. The event was hosted by Diva Jackie Dupree, with music provided by DJ TK. Judge Linda Poust-Lopez received an award in an announcement made on the night of the event.
